Princeton University Mathematics Competition普林斯顿大学数学竞赛(简称:PUMaC)自2006年起由Princeton University Math Club普林斯顿大学数学俱乐部全权举办,并由普林斯顿大学的学生进行组织。
该竞赛是一项面向国际高中生的世界范围内最顶尖的数学学科竞赛,每年都将汇聚世界各地热爱数学的优秀中学生,共同分享数学学科的乐趣,并进行专业竞技,角逐各大奖项。
PUMaC旨在激励并培养高中生对数学学科的兴趣和热爱,让学生接触到创造性思维和严谨的应用技能。同时,帮助学生们享受解决问题的乐趣,并发现传统意义上枯燥和深奥问题中所蕴含的趣味。
PUMaC普林斯顿大学数学竞赛备赛辅导课程大纲
1、Number Theory
Essential Topics(1):Prime factorization
Extended Details (Divison A and Beyond):
—Number of factors
—Sum/Product of factors
—LCM and GCD
—Euclidean Algorithm and Bézout's Theorem
Essential Topics(2):Congruence and Modular Algebra
Extended Details (Divison A and Beyond):
—Chinese Remainder Theorem(CRT)
—Euler’s Theorem/Fermat's Little Theorem
—Wilson's Theorem
Essential Topics(3):Diphantine Equations
Extended Details (Divison A and Beyond):
—*Pell's Equation and Approximation Method
2、Algebra
Essential Topics(1):Resursive Sequences
Extended Details (Divison A and Beyond):
—Characteristic Equation Method
—Conjecture and Mathematical Induction Proof
Essential Topics(2):Functions and Equations
Extended Details (Divison A and Beyond):
—Gaussian/Floor function
—Functional Equations
Essential Topics(3):Inequalities and Extreme Value Problems
Extended Details (Divison A and Beyond):
—Cauchy inequality
—Jensen's inequality
—Weighted AM-GM Inequality
—Rearrangement Inequality and Chebyshev Inequality
Essential Topics(4):Polynomials
Extended Details (Divison A and Beyond):
—Fundamental Theorem of Algebra (Polynomial Factorization)
—Generalized Remainder's Theorem
—Rational Root Theorem
—Vieta's Theorem and Newton's Sums
Essential Topics(5):Complex numbers
Extended Details (Divison A and Beyond):
—De Moivre's Theorem and Roots of unity
—Rotation, Translation and Complex Vector Method
3、Geometry
Essential Topics(1):Basic Geometry (Triangles and Polygons)
Extended Details (Divison A and Beyond):
—The Law of Sines, The Law of Cosines
—Area Method and Heron's formula
—Centers of triangle
—Menelaus's theorem, Ceva's theorem, Stewart Theorem
Essential Topics(2):Circles
Extended Details (Divison A and Beyond):
—Inscribed and circumscribed polygon/Circle, Cyclic Quadrilateral
—Ptolemy's theorem, Butterfly Theorem, Simson's Theorem
Essential Topics(3):Basic Analytic Geometry
Extended Details (Divison A and Beyond):
—Ellipse, *Parabola and Hyperbola
Essential Topics(4):Basic Solid Geometry
Extended Details (Divison A and Beyond):
—*Euler's Polyhedron Formula
4、Combinatorics
Essential Topics(1):Basic Counting Principle
Extended Details (Divison A and Beyond):
—Basic Counting Principle
Essential Topics(2):Permutations and Combinations
Extended Details (Divison A and Beyond):
—Advanced problems in combinatorics
Essential Topics(3):Logic reasoning
Extended Details (Divison A and Beyond):
—Pigeonhole principle
Essential Topics(4):*Baisc Graph Theory
Extended Details (Divison A and Beyond):
—Ramsey's Theory
